What does a Graphic Designer do?
A Graphic Designer is a creative professional who uses visual elements to communicate ideas and messages. They work on numerous projects including branding, advertising, print design, web design, and packaging. Graphic Designers are responsible for creating visually appealing layouts, selecting color schemes, and working with typography. They often collaborate with clients to understand their vision and objectives, translating these into engaging designs. Proficient in design software like Adobe Creative Suite, they utilize their skills to produce high-quality visual content that resonates with target audiences. Their work can significantly influence a brand’s identity and market presence.

What qualities set exceptional Graphic Designers apart from the rest?
Exceptional Graphic Designers possess a combination of creativity, technical skills, and effective communication. They have a strong portfolio showcasing diverse projects, demonstrating adaptability and innovation. These designers stay updated with design trends and software advancements, ensuring their work is relevant and impactful. Additionally, strong problem-solving skills enable them to navigate challenges creatively. Good Graphic Designers also excel in collaboration, understanding client needs while providing constructive feedback. Their attention to detail ensures that every aspect of a design, from color choices to typography, aligns with the project’s goals, setting them apart in a competitive field.

What’s the difference between hiring a freelance Graphic Designer and working with an agency in Melbourne, AU?
Hiring a freelance Graphic Designer often offers flexibility, cost-effectiveness, and direct communication. Freelancers can provide personalized attention to your project, adapting quickly to changes. However, they may lack the extensive resources that an agency offers. Agencies typically have a diverse team of specialists, providing a broader range of services, support, and reliability for larger projects. They often have established processes and can manage timelines effectively. Consider your project scale and complexity when deciding; freelancers may suit smaller projects, while agencies are ideal for comprehensive, multifaceted campaigns.
